Regional taxes: These taxes are based on the tax rate adopted by the Region of Waterloo. This portion is remitted to the Region to support their role in supplying various services including public transit, waste ... That’s not far off from the proposed budget ... WebKitchener Property Tax Update. Kitchener’s proposed budget for 2024 includes a 4.8% property tax hike. For an average home with an assessed value of $326,000, the tax hike would result in an additional $56 in annual property taxes.
